I recently had a motor rebuilt an can't get warm idle rpm below 1000. Is this normal what's the process to check.

Idle on scanmaster shows 00
Tps at .42

Should I set IAC again?
 
Sounds like you have an "idle air" leak somewhere that the idle air control valve cant control. Stock idle is whatever is programmed into the chip. Usually 750/850 rpm.

If you mean IAC = 0 then the ECM is trying to bring the idle down and it's as far as it can go. If you have no vac leaks you need to close the throttle blade some (and reset the TPS back to .42) OR you need to verify the IAC pintle and socket are clean. If there's crud in there it can let in too much idle air.

It could be something dumb like a bad PCV that's letting too much air into the system (among other things as well)
